The Importance Of Pharma Services Group In The Healthcare Industry

In the ever-evolving world of healthcare, pharmaceutical companies play a crucial role in developing, manufacturing, and distributing medications to improve the health and well-being of individuals. Behind the scenes, pharmaceutical services groups are essential components that support the operations of these companies. These groups provide a wide range of services that are vital to the success of pharmaceutical companies, ensuring that medications are safe, effective, and readily available to patients around the world.

A pharma services group is a specialized organization that offers a variety of services to pharmaceutical companies, ranging from research and development to regulatory compliance and marketing. These groups are composed of experts in various fields, including scientists, researchers, regulatory affairs specialists, and marketing professionals. By working closely with pharmaceutical companies, pharma services groups help ensure that medications are developed, tested, and marketed in a manner that meets regulatory standards and maximizes the potential for success in the marketplace.

One of the key functions of a pharma services group is research and development. Pharmaceutical companies rely on these groups to conduct research, design experiments, and analyze data to develop new medications that address unmet medical needs. The research and development process is complex and time-consuming, requiring a high level of expertise in various scientific disciplines. pharma services groups provide the necessary skills and resources to support pharmaceutical companies in their efforts to bring new medications to market.

Another important role of a pharma services group is regulatory compliance. In order for medications to be approved for use by regulatory agencies such as the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) in the United States, pharmaceutical companies must demonstrate that their products are safe, effective, and manufactured according to strict guidelines. pharma services groups assist companies in preparing regulatory submissions, conducting compliance audits, and ensuring that medications meet all regulatory requirements. By partnering with these groups, pharmaceutical companies can navigate the complex regulatory landscape more effectively and bring their products to market in a timely manner.

In addition to research and development and regulatory compliance, pharma services groups also play a crucial role in marketing and sales support. Once a medication is approved for use, pharmaceutical companies must effectively communicate the benefits of their products to healthcare providers, patients, and payers. pharma services groups help companies develop marketing strategies, create promotional materials, and conduct market research to identify opportunities for growth. By leveraging the expertise of these groups, pharmaceutical companies can increase awareness of their products and drive sales in competitive markets.
